Earlier this week, I attended the exclusive VIP preview of the brand’s boutique pop-up in Holt Renfrew at Yorkdale Mall in Toronto. The day after, the pop-up opened to the public, and will run from Sept.22 to Sept.25, 2016.
It’s a fun concept. Visitors can shop items from the fall/winter 2016 ready-to-wear collection, including purses, blouses, shoes, jewelry, coats and various outerwear. In addition, they can purchase the first-ever Miu Miu fragrance.
The brand is also presenting its CustoMIUzation project where it offers clients the opportunity to personalize bags in denim with a large selection of characteristically playful patches. Think bright stars, colourful symbols and a variety of labels. Approximately a dozen of different CustoMIUzation patches are available to choose from and a dedicated artisan, flown in from Italy, is in attendance to heat seal patches to each bag. No two bags will be the same. To make the project even more exclusive, the total number of bags available for CustoMIUzation is strictly limited.
